Why Greater Upper Marlboro Homes Are Different
Upper Marlboro sits directly on the Marlboro Clay - a high-plasticity marine clay formation that literally takes its name from this town. The clay swells when wet and shrinks when dry, which means gate posts set in it shift with the seasons. A gate that was plumb in October is dragging by March. That’s why we check post plumb on every repair call, and why re-grouting a post base is standard practice here, not an upsell.
The 20773 ZIP is heavy with equestrian estates and large-lot rural properties along Croom Road and the Patuxent corridor. Those gates are typically tubular steel farm gates or heavy ornamental iron swing gates on timber or masonry posts. They’ve been up for decades, and the freeze-thaw cycles of a DC-area winter have been working on the welds every year. Summer humidity above 70% also accelerates rust pitting on bare steel pipe. Meanwhile, the newer subdivisions like Marlboro Meadows have lighter aluminum driveway gates from the 1990s and 2000s that are now reaching end-of-hardware life.
Low-lying parcels near the Patuxent River and its tributaries stay exceptionally wet in spring, compounding the clay’s already severe post-heaving tendency and corroding buried hardware faster than on higher ground. A technician working the Croom Road corridor quickly learns that a “leaning gate” call here almost always means the Marlboro Clay has moved the post, not that the hinge hardware failed.

Electric Gate Repair
An electric gate that won’t open after a power cut in Greater Upper Marlboro is usually a control board fault, a dead capacitor, or a stripped gear inside the operator. We service Viking, Ghost Controls, DoorKing, and other major brands, and we stock common parts locally so we’re not waiting a week on a shipped board. Before you force a gate open by hand, call us. Forcing an electric slide gate without releasing the operator is how rack and pinion teeth get sheared, and that’s a $400 repair that could have been a $220 board swap.
Hinge & Post Repair
This is the repair that matters most in the 20773 ZIP. Gate posts set in Marlboro Clay heave and tilt seasonally. The clay swells with winter moisture and shrinks during summer dry spells, which slowly works the post out of level. A gate sags in the hinge post, not in the middle, and that is where we start. We reset the post, re-grout the base, and re-hang the gate with new hardware when the old hinge leaves are bent or rusted through. Fix the panel without the post and you’ll fix it twice. A hinge and post reset in Greater Upper Marlboro typically runs $180 to $340.

Why does my gate post keep leaning every spring in Upper Marlboro even after I had it straightened?
Your post is set in the Marlboro Clay formation, which expands when saturated with winter moisture and contracts during summer dry spells. Each cycle works the post farther out of plumb. Straightening the post without improving the footing is temporary. The permanent fix is re-setting the post in a deeper concrete collar with drainage, then re-hanging the gate square. Swing Gate Installation
Swing gates are the most common style on the estate lots and farm properties along the Croom Road corridor. In Greater Upper Marlboro, the single biggest failure we see is not the gate itself but the hinge post heaving out of plumb in the Marlboro Clay. We set posts deeper than code minimum, use belled concrete bases with galvanized anchors, and backfill with crushed stone so water drains away instead of pooling against the post. A single ornamental steel swing gate on a 12-foot residential opening in Greater Upper Marlboro typically runs $2,800 to $4,600 installed, including those deeper footings this soil demands.
Double Gate Installation
Double gates are common on long private drives in Greater Upper Marlboro where the opening is too wide for a single panel. The challenge is that both posts have to stay plumb relative to each other, or the leaves bind at the center. On Marlboro Clay, that means both footings have to be set the same way, to the same depth, with the same drainage plan. One post moving even an inch is enough to throw the latch out of alignment. A double gate installation lands between $4,800 and $8,000 depending on width, steel weight, and opener type.

Do I need a special post footing for a gate on Marlboro Clay?
Yes. Marlboro Clay is a high-plasticity marine clay that expands and contracts significantly with moisture changes. A standard 36-inch footing will heave and tilt seasonally. We recommend a 48-inch minimum depth with a belled base, galvanized post anchors, and crushed-stone backfill to keep water from pooling against the post. This is the single most important specification for any gate in Greater Upper Marlboro, and skipping it is the most common reason we get called back to fix someone else’s installation. Linear Motor Service
Linear arm operators are common on estate gates around Greater Upper Marlboro because they handle heavy gates without a below-ground box. But they hate binding. If the post has shifted even a degree and a half, the linear arm fights the rack and draws high current every cycle. We see this constantly along the Croom Road corridor. A proper Linear motor service here means checking post plumb, greasing the rack, setting the force limits correctly, and verifying the safety photocells still align at both ends of travel.

Why does my gate motor trip its safety photocell every spring even when nothing is in the path?
In Greater Upper Marlboro, the most common cause is seasonal movement of the hinge post in the Marlboro Clay, not a failed sensor. The clay absorbs winter moisture, expands, and shifts the post just enough to move the gate’s swing arc. The operator reads that misalignment as an obstruction. Why does my slide gate screech and lag when opening after a wet week in Upper Marlboro?
That’s grit and clay slurry in the track and on the drive chain. The low-lying ground near the Patuxent River tributaries stays saturated for weeks in spring, and every cycle pulls more abrasive slurry into the mechanism. The screeching is metal grinding on contaminated lubricant. Left alone, it will strip the drive gear or burn out the motor bearings. We clean the track, flush the chain, and re-lubricate. Hinge Replacement
On farm gates and older ornamental iron gates in Greater Upper Marlboro, hinge failure usually starts at the post, not the hinge itself. When a hinge post shifts in Marlboro Clay, the hinge pin gets side-loaded, wears oval, and eventually snaps or galls. We cut off the old hinge, weld in a new heavier barrel or strap hinge, and set the post so the load runs true. A typical hinge replacement on a standard farm gate runs $180 to $340 including the new hinge hardware and weld work.

Can you weld a new post onto an existing concrete footing in my 20773 horse farm gate?
Usually the whole footing needs to be dug out and replaced. If the Marlboro Clay has moved the post, the concrete around it is almost always cracked, tilted, or no longer deep enough to hold. You can weld a new post onto the old base, but you’ll be welding to a footing that’s still moving. In Greater Upper Marlboro’s expansive clay, a proper repair means digging below the active heave zone and starting fresh. Call (877) 610-2993 and we’ll assess it.
